The cheapest way to get from Newhaven to Tonbridge is to drive which costs £8 - £13 and takes 53 min.
The fastest way to get from Newhaven to Tonbridge is to drive which takes 53 min and costs £8 - £13.
No, there is no direct bus from Newhaven to Tonbridge. However, there are services departing from Elim Church and arriving at Castle via Royal Pavilion and Railway Station. The journey, including transfers, takes approximately 3h 18m.
No, there is no direct train from Newhaven to Tonbridge. However, there are services departing from Newhaven Town and arriving at Tonbridge via Lewes, Gatwick Airport and Redhill. The journey, including transfers, takes approximately 2h 22m.
The distance between Newhaven and Tonbridge is 55 miles. The road distance is 35.9 miles.
The best way to get from Newhaven to Tonbridge without a car is to train which takes 2h 22m and costs £24 - £60.
It takes approximately 2h 22m to get from Newhaven to Tonbridge, including transfers.
Newhaven to Tonbridge bus services, operated by Brighton & Hove, depart from Royal Pavilion station.
Newhaven to Tonbridge train services, operated by Southern, depart from Lewes station.
The best way to get from Newhaven to Tonbridge is to train which takes 2h 22m and costs £24 - £60. Alternatively, you can bus, which costs £12 - £16 and takes 3h 18m.
